cstdio和stdio.h的区别 cstdio是将stdio.h的内容用C++头文件的形式表示出来。stdio.h是C标准函数库中的头文件,即:standard buffered input&output。提供基本的文字的输入输出流操作(包括屏幕和文件等)。由于C语言并没有提供专用于文字输入输出的关键字,所以该库是最普遍的C语言程序加载库。 cstdio 和 stdio.h是...
在C语言中,stdio.h 头文件是主要的。而在后来的C++语言中,C只是C++的一个子集,且C++中,已不推荐再用C的类库,但为了对已有代码的保护,还是对原来的头文件支持。cstdio文件的内容是这样的:if <TRADITIONAL C HEADERS> include <stdio.h> namespace std { using ::fclose;using ::feof;using...
然后在cpp文件中引入该头文件,但我们却无法使用之前写好的东西。 #include "aa.h"//无法引用INT a = 10; INT a会报错,因为我们只引入了头文件,没有使用里面的名称空间。 需要再加入: using namespace AA;或者using AA::INT; 指针和数组名的区别 (指针是变量,数组名是一个地址常量) #include<iostream usi...
不是,string.h对应的cstring,string是C++的标准头文件,在C中没有对应的东西。